如何设计一个模糊控制器来处理温度偏差E,并根据模糊控制系统的原理完成温度的自动调节?请提供详细步骤和概念解析。
时间: 2024-11-20 13:46:34 浏览: 24
为了帮助你构建一个模糊控制器以处理温度偏差E,并实现温度的自动调节,我建议你查阅《模糊控制理论:温度偏差E的隶属函数与模糊关系详解》。这本书详细介绍了模糊控制的基础知识和应用技巧,特别是对于温度偏差的处理和模糊控制器的构造有着深入的讲解。
参考资源链接:[模糊控制理论:温度偏差E的隶属函数与模糊关系详解](https://wenku.csdn.net/doc/7yd604ddiq?spm=1055.2569.3001.10343)
首先,设计一个模糊控制器涉及以下几个步骤:
1. 确定输入变量和输出变量。在这个场景中,输入变量是温度偏差E,输出变量是控制输出量U。
2. 定义输入和输出变量的模糊集。例如,温度偏差E可以分为“低温”、“适中”和“高温”,控制输出量U可以根据偏差的大小定义不同的模糊控制动作。
3. 构建隶属函数。隶属函数用来量化温度偏差的程度,比如可以用三角形、梯形或高斯型等数学函数来定义。
4. 设计模糊规则。模糊规则描述了输入变量与输出变量之间的模糊关系,例如:“如果温度偏差是‘低温’,那么控制输出是‘增加热量’”。
5. 实现模糊推理。模糊推理基于模糊规则和当前的输入值(温度偏差),计算出对应的输出值(控制输出量)。
6. 解模糊化。由于模糊推理的结果是一个模糊集合,我们需要将其转化为一个具体的控制信号,常见的方法有重心法、最大隶属度法等。
在实际应用中,模糊控制器的构造需要考虑硬件和软件两个方面。硬件方面,控制器需要有足够的输入输出接口来实时监控温度传感器的数据,并控制加热或冷却设备。软件方面,则要实现上述的模糊处理算法。
通过这样的步骤,模糊控制器可以模拟人类的决策过程,根据模糊的输入信息推导出合理的控制输出,从而实现对温度的有效调节。如果你希望深入了解模糊控制系统的更多细节和高级应用,建议继续参阅《模糊控制理论:温度偏差E的隶属函数与模糊关系详解》。这本书将提供更全面的视角和更深入的理论支持,帮助你掌握模糊控制的精髓。
参考资源链接:[模糊控制理论:温度偏差E的隶属函数与模糊关系详解](https://wenku.csdn.net/doc/7yd604ddiq?spm=1055.2569.3001.10343)
阅读全文